From 33b5e2d3ced61b4c9c2eb828945e276f2807064d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Wed, 18 Oct 2023 21:31:55 +0000 Subject: [PATCH 1/2] Bump apicurio-registry.version from 2.4.7.Final to 2.4.14.Final --- bom/application/pom.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/bom/application/pom.xml b/bom/application/pom.xml index df4707a686811..3b33db87b0c04 100644 --- a/bom/application/pom.xml +++ b/bom/application/pom.xml @@ -206,7 +206,7 @@ 2.20.0 1.3.0.Final 1.11.3 - 2.4.7.Final + 2.4.14.Final 0.1.18.Final 1.19.1 3.3.3 From 9e7b2c1e6f44e0843e558c887d5f39df12438298 Mon Sep 17 00:00:00 2001 From: Ozan Gunalp Date: Thu, 26 Oct 2023 16:08:14 +0200 Subject: [PATCH 2/2] Kafka Confluent avro schema serializer doc update Resolves #36372 --- .../asciidoc/kafka-schema-registry-avro.adoc | 23 +++++++++++++++---- .../kafka-avro-apicurio2/pom.xml | 6 ++++- 2 files changed, 23 insertions(+), 6 deletions(-) diff --git a/docs/src/main/asciidoc/kafka-schema-registry-avro.adoc b/docs/src/main/asciidoc/kafka-schema-registry-avro.adoc index 51d3a68b84cb4..ca1b4c787a759 100644 --- a/docs/src/main/asciidoc/kafka-schema-registry-avro.adoc +++ b/docs/src/main/asciidoc/kafka-schema-registry-avro.adoc @@ -795,12 +795,25 @@ dependencies { ---- In JVM mode, any version of `io.confluent:kafka-avro-serializer` can be used. -In native mode, Quarkus only supports the following versions: +In native mode, Quarkus supports the following versions: `6.2.x`, `7.0.x`, `7.1.x`, `7.2.x`, `7.3.x`. -* 6.2.x -* 7.0.x -* 7.1.x -* 7.2.x +For version `7.4.x` and `7.5.x`, due to an issue with the Confluent Schema Serializer, you need to add another dependency: + +[source,xml,role="primary asciidoc-tabs-target-sync-cli asciidoc-tabs-target-sync-maven"] +.pom.xml +---- + + com.fasterxml.jackson.dataformat + jackson-dataformat-csv + +---- +[source,gradle,role="secondary asciidoc-tabs-target-sync-gradle"] +.build.gradle +---- +dependencies { + implementation("com.fasterxml.jackson.dataformat:jackson-dataformat-csv") +} +---- For any other versions, the native configuration may need to be adjusted. diff --git a/integration-tests/kafka-avro-apicurio2/pom.xml b/integration-tests/kafka-avro-apicurio2/pom.xml index 7a7920b4b9170..e6285d058e17e 100644 --- a/integration-tests/kafka-avro-apicurio2/pom.xml +++ b/integration-tests/kafka-avro-apicurio2/pom.xml @@ -57,7 +57,7 @@ io.confluent kafka-avro-serializer - 7.2.1 + 7.5.1 org.checkerframework @@ -65,6 +65,10 @@ + + com.fasterxml.jackson.dataformat + jackson-dataformat-csv + io.quarkus